Patents Are Expensive. Bad Patents Are Even More Expensive.

Patenting the wrong idea or failing to protect the right one are two of the costliest mistakes innovation managers can make. Here is why:

Wasted money on patents that don’t drive business value.

Lost opportunities as competitors capitalize on unprotected ideas.

A cluttered, weak patent portfolio that does not help your business.

Hence, you need a clear, objective way to separate the good from the great.
